Travel from Japan to Vietnam partially resumes

A plane full of Japanese business travelers has landed in Vietnam for the first time since the coronavirus pandemic prompted each country to issue travel bans.

The countries agreed to ease restrictions since local infections appear to be under control.

Evacuation order partially lifted in Futaba Town

An evacuation order that's been in place since the 2011 nuclear accident has been lifted in some parts of Futaba Town, Fukushima Prefecture.

The order was lifted on Wednesday for nearly 5 percent of the town that co-hosts the Fukushima Daiichi nuclear plant.

Evacuation order to be partially lifted in 3 towns

An evacuation order that has been enforced in three towns in Fukushima Prefecture, northern Japan, since the 2011 nuclear accident will be partially lifted in March.

The Japanese government reached the decision at a meeting of the nuclear disaster taskforce attended by Prime Minister Shinzo Abe on Friday.
